The Stable, the pizza and cider concept, in which Fuller’s has a majority stake, has placed its site in Bath on the market, as it looks to move to a larger site in the city, M&C Report has learnt.

A Fuller’s spokesperson said: “We can confirm that we are in negotiations regarding a larger site in Bath for our craft cider and gourmet pizza restaurant, The Stable. As a result, we are in the process of moving from our current site and it is, therefore, on the market.

“We are delighted with our success in Bath and are looking forward to welcoming new and current customers to our new site when we open.”

The seven-strong brand is close to finalising terms on four new sites which will open in the next 12 months.

These will all be in character properties and in university towns and cities.

M&C Report believes Cardiff and Southampton are two of the four locations the group is lining up.

An eighth opening has already been secured in Plymouth for next spring.

Fuller’s acquired a 51% stake in The Stable, the then six-strong craft cider and pizza restaurant business, for £7.3m, earlier this year.
